Objective
This training will give the participants an in-depth and concrete insight into the right to equal recognition before the law under Article 12 of the UNCRPD and the UNCRPD Committee’s General Comment no. 1, as well as the safeguards and standards it entails.
Legal capacity affects all aspects of the life of persons with disabilities and there is a need for better understanding of the obligations of States Parties to ensure supported decision-making for all persons with disabilities and how this can be organised at national and local level effectively and with legal guarantees.
